RAMON Socias, the Spanish Government's Representative in the Balearics, said yesterday that in his opinion the creation of a single command for the Guardia Civil and the National Police Force, directed by the Majorcan Joan Mesquida, will avoid “terrible events like March 11”. During a press conference, Socias said that there had been a “coordination failure” and a lack of information flow between the two forces during the bombings in Madrid on March 11 2004. According to Socias, the installation of this office, which unites the management of the Guardia Civil and the National Police Force, “will increase coordination between the two”. Socias said that if it had been “good news” that a Majorcan had been appointed director general of the Guardia Civil, the announcement that he had been chosen to be the director of the National Police Force as well was “even better”. Socias said that the creation of this post was the fulfilment of one of the electoral promises of the PSOE (Spanish Socialists), who stated this intention in their manifesto.
